Full-bore

adjective

  1. Thoroughgoing; complete; total.

    He is full-bore environmental activist.

  2. (of a firearm) Having a relatively large caliber.

    Mounted on the wall was a full-bore elephant gun.

Synonyms: full-blown, full-fledged

adverb

  1. At top speed; with full power.

    The car raced full-bore into oncoming traffic.

Synonyms: full tilt boogie
